How To Capture Screenshot in Microsoft Windows (PC)


Taking Screenshot of Entire Screen

1 - Press the 'Print Scrn' button on your keyboard to take a picture of full screen .

2 - Open Microsoft Paint. You can find it in Start Menu → All Programs → Accessories → Paint.

 3 - Click 'Paste' button in the upper left corner of Microsoft Paint. You can also press 'CTRL+ V' to paste.

Capturing One Window Screenshot

1 - Press the 'Ctrrl+Print Scrn' button simultaneously on your keyboard to take a picture of one window.

2 - As earlier, ppen Microsoft Paint through this path: Start Menu → All Programs → Accessories → Paint.

 3 - Click 'Paste' button in the upper left corner or simultaneously press 'CTRL+ V' button to paste.

There is also a much more easier method but it only works in Windows 8 and Windows 10.

Taking Screenshot in Windows 8 and Windows 10

1 - Just Press 'Windows+Print Scrn' buttons simultaneously on your keyboard. The screenshot will be saved automatically in Pictures → Screenshot folder.
